Rep. Wale Raji Celebrates Hon. Dr. Olusegun Agbaje on His Birthday, Commends His Dedication to Public Service

Member of the House of Representatives representing Epe Federal Constituency, Hon. Wale Raji, has extended warm felicitations to Hon. Dr. Olusegun Agbaje, Commissioner III of the Lagos State Teaching Service Commission (TESCOM), on the occasion of his birthday.

EpeInsights reports that in a goodwill message personally signed by him, Rep. Raji described Dr. Agbaje fondly called Olu-Omo as an “amiable public servant and a dear brother whose life embodies dedication and unwavering commitment to service.”

The lawmaker noted that Dr. Agbaje has continued to distinguish himself through his passion for human capital development and his tireless support for good governance in Lagos State. He praised the TESCOM Commissioner for his selfless devotion to improving public education and his role in strengthening the teaching profession in the state.

“Olu-Omo, you are a man whose life epitomizes dedication and humility. Your passion for human capital development and support for good governance reflect your selfless devotion to building a better society,” Rep. Raji stated.

He further commended Dr. Agbaje’s outstanding contributions to the progress of Lagos, describing him as a true patriot and visionary leader whose work continues to impact both the education sector and the wider community.

Rep. Raji prayed that the Almighty grants Dr. Agbaje continued sound health, divine wisdom and renewed strength to sustain his journey of impactful service to humanity and the state.

“On this joyous occasion, I celebrate your inspiring life and significant contributions to our collective progress. May the Almighty continue to bless you with sound health, divine wisdom, and renewed strength,” he added.

The Epe lawmaker concluded his message by wishing the celebrant a happy birthday filled with joy and fulfillment, expressing confidence that his leadership and integrity would continue to inspire others in the public service.

Hon. Dr. Olusegun Agbaje currently serves as Commissioner III at the Lagos State Teaching Service Commission, where he plays a strategic role in policy formulation, teacher welfare, and the enhancement of education delivery across the state.
